Output 918f6b840c1c3abad1101c07c2d59d3cafb037db85c0e4df4565c108f2e34754:2

value
10300515153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16c154635506a4696a6f6ae381092f66df06f24 OP_EQUAL
address
3NEwST89dFrZL4hSNkm2iB3Bu2D7CSWP6y
transaction
918f6b840c1c3abad1101c07c2d59d3cafb037db85c0e4df4565c108f2e34754
spent
true